WebMar 18, 2024 · 9. Create a low-maintenance Japanese-inspired front yard. Japanese-inspired garden designs are perfect for small and simple front yards. The combination of gravel and slow-growing species of cedar and maple, grasses and moss, is very low-maintenance but looks amazing. Bur oak (Quercus macrocarpa)With strong branches, deep roots, and a dense shade-protective canopy, bur oak is the tree superhero your lawn has been looking for. Native to the Great Lakes region, it’s a large, fast grower prized for its winter hardiness, insect and deer resistance, and ability to thrive in poor soil. イビデン大垣中央事業場WebMay 31, 2024 · 5.
